About Ballymaloe Shop

In 1972, Wendy Whelan started the shop at Ballymaloe House, as an exciting addition to the existing business her mother Myrtle Allen had created.

The Ballymaloe Shop is located in a charming old farm building located next to Ballymaloe House. Here you will find a carefully selected, competitively priced range of Irish designer goods, crafts and specialist kitchenware.

There is beautiful blue Burleigh pottery, Irish knitwear, scarves and rugs by Foxford and John Hanly, handblown Jerpoint glass, Le Pentole saucepans and all sorts of kitchenware, Nicholas Mosse pottery, chunky chopping boards from Sacha Whelan, Cookery Books, Ballymaloe Christmas Hampers and lots more.
